NRL LIVE: Eels shut out Raiders in first half as they look to snap losing streak


A big blow for the Raiders now as halfback Ethan Sanders takes out Brian Kelly as the Eels winger attempts to chase a kick into the Canberra in-goal. The bunker takes a look at it and rule out a penalty try, but instead Sanders is sent to the sin bin for a professional foul. With Sanders’ usual halves partner Ethan Strange away on Origin duty, the Raiders are very light on playmaking experience for the next 10 minutes.

The Eels attack Sanders’ usual place in the defensive line immediately and second-rower Kelma Tuilagi crashes through, reaches out and … drops the ball over the line. Or does he? The ball rolls out of his grasp as he tries to slam it down on the tryline, but the on-field referee awards the try. The bunker takes a look, and it’s very close, but the try is confirmed.

That looks like a tough call on the Raiders but the Eels won’t mind one bit, and they are in a great spot – even after a couple of missed conversion attempts.

Eels 8, Raiders 0 after 26 minutes
